s:select 标签

<s:select theme="simple" cssStyle="width:70px" list="userList" listKey="id" listValue="name" name="testId" id="testId" headerKey="" headerValue="" value="%{user.id}"></s:select>

 

s:select标签默认被tr和td围绕,加上theme="simple"就可以解决自动换行的问题

cssStyle 设置css 属性

list  userList是List类型对象,是要显示的集合

listKey  值id是调用对象中getId方法

listValue 值name是调用对象中getName方法

name对应HTML标签的name

id 对应HTML标签的id

headerKey是默认头部显示的值的id

headerValue是默认头部显示的元素的值

value 采用ognl语言,参数是当前传过来对象的id值,select标签会根据这个 value值与listvalue值是否相同决定当前条目是否默认显示。达到一种修改时可以保持原选择内容的效果。

 

 

参考:

http://wudi1906.javaeye.com/blog/576824

http://www.mkyong.com/struts2/struts-2-sselect-drop-down-box-example/

http://xzhsht.blog.163.com/blog/static/5967507220100124728503/

http://zhidao.baidu.com/question/114070038.html

http://www.javaeye.com/problems/11592

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值